Gillen Broadcasting Owner & GM Doug Gillen Dies

The longtime owner of Gainesville-based Gillen Broadcasting has died. Douglas J. Gillen was the owner and General Manager of Gillen Broadcasting, which operates CHR WYKS-FM (KISS 105.3) and Urban WAJD-AM & W255CV (98.9 JAMZ). The Gillen family acquired the stations in 1987, and Gillen served as General Manager for nearly 40 years.
In a statement, Gillen Broadcasting said it is mourning the loss of its founder and owner, describing him as a steady presence who preferred to remain behind the scenes while supporting his on-air talent and staff.
"For nearly 40 years Doug was quietly a pillar of our local community, preferring to stand behind the spotlight of his DJs," the company said. "A philanthropist at heart who freely gave to raise awareness to local charities. Yet no one could have done more to support local businesses in our area and take such joy in seeing them thrive."
The statement also credited Gillen with helping launch and shape numerous broadcasting careers, with some remaining in Gainesville and others moving on to national and international opportunities.
"More than just a boss, he was a beloved mentor, friend, and father figure. He left a legacy that will continue through us," the company said, adding that it plans to continue operating KISS 105.3 and 98.9 JAMZ in keeping with his vision and leadership.
